    Fans of the Star Trek 'universe' have some shorthand acronyms when referring to the different series, characters, episodes, etc.

    TOS - The Original Series
    TNG - The Next Generation (the second television series, started 1987)
    DS9 - Deep Space Nine - the spinoff series from TNG

    Scotty's kilt wearing was discussed on XMTS in this thread. In summary, he rarely wore it, he had a fly plaid, and it was in the Scott Black and White tartan.
